Vomiting, stomach pain, nausea and indigestion are some of the common side effects that might be observed on taking this medicine. It may also cause dizziness, drowsiness or visual disturbances. Your doctor may regularly monitor your kidney function, liver function and levels of blood components, if you are taking this medicine for long-term treatment. Long term use may lead to serious complications such as stomach bleeding and kidney problems.
How Justin 12.5mg Injection works
Justin 12.5mg Injection is a non-steroidal anti-inflammatory drugs (NSAID). It works by blocking the release of certain chemical messengers that cause pain and inflammation (redness and swelling).

Caution is advised when consuming alcohol with Justin 12.5mg Injection. Please consult your doctor.
Justin 12.5mg Injection is unsafe to use during pregnancy as there is definite evidence of risk to the developing baby. However, the doctor may rarely prescribe it in some life-threatening situations if the benefits are more than the potential risks. Please consult your doctor.
Justin 12.5mg Injection is probably safe to use during breastfeeding. Limited human data suggests that the drug does not represent any significant risk to the baby.
Justin 12.5mg Injection may cause side effects which could affect your ability to drive.<BR>Justin 12.5mg Injection may cause headaches, blurred vision, dizziness or drowsiness in some patients. This may affect your ability to drive.
Justin 12.5mg Injection should be used with caution in patients with kidney disease. Dose adjustment of Justin 12.5mg Injection may be needed. Please consult your doctor.
Justin 12.5mg Injection should be used with caution in patients with liver disease. Dose adjustment of Justin 12.5mg Injection may be needed. Please consult your doctor.<BR>Regular monitoring of liver function tests is recommended in patients with liver disease if this medicine is to be taken for a long time.
